English Safety precautions
Do not use means to accelerate
the defrosting process or
to clean, other than those
recommended by manufacturer.
Any un t method or using
incompatible material may cause
product damage, burst and
serious injury.
Do not pierce or burn as the
appliance is pressurized. Do not
expose the appliance to heat,
ame, sparks, or other sources
of ignition. Else it may explode
and cause injury or death.
Do not install the unit in
a potentially explosive or
ammable atmosphere.
Failure to do so could result in
re.
Do not insert your ngers
or other objects into the
air conditioner indoor or
outdoor unit, rotating parts
may cause injury.
Do not touch the outdoor unit
during lightning, it may cause
electric shock.
Do not expose yourself directly
to cold air for a long period to
avoid excess cooling.
Do not sit or step on the
unit, you may fall down
accidentally.
Remote control
Do not allow infants and small
children to play with the remote
control to prevent them from
accidentally swallowing the
batteries.
Power supply
Do not use a
modi ed cord, joint
cord, extension cord
or unspeci ed cord to
prevent overheating
and re.
To prevent overheating, re or
electric shock:
Do not share the same power
outlet with other equipment.
Do not operate with wet hands.
Do not over bend the power
supply cord.
Do not operate or stop the unit
by inserting or pulling out the
power plug.
If the supply cord is damaged,
it must be replaced by the
manufacturer, service agent or
similarly quali ed persons in
order to avoid a hazard.
It is strongly recommended to
be installed with Earth Leakage
Circuit Breaker (ELCB) or
Residual Current Device (RCD)
to prevent electric shock or re.
To prevent overheating, re or
electric shock:
Insert the power plug properly.
Dust on the power plug should
be periodically wiped with a dry
cloth.
Stop using the product if any
abnormality/failure occurs and
disconnect the power plug or
turn off the power switch and
breaker.
(Risk of smoke/ re/electric
shock)
Examples of abnormality/failure
The ELCB trips frequently.
Burning smell is observed.
Abnormal noise or vibration of
the unit is observed.
Water leaks from the indoor unit.
Power cord or plug becomes
abnormally hot.
Fan speed cannot be controlled.
The unit stops running
immediately even if it is
switched on for operation.
The fan does not stop even if
the operation is stopped.
Contact your local dealer
immediately for maintenance/
repair.
